Misfits that Win

The San Francisco Giants have won the World Series, kudos to them, what an effort. Nobody would have given them a snowflakes chance at the beginning of the season, which makes the feat even more exemplary. Giants Manager Bruce Bochy, said the team won because of it's the diversity and a contribution from everybody. Bochy said in response to being asked what stood out to him about this particular team. "This is not a team that has one star carrying it. It took 25 guys to do this. They set aside their own egos or agendas." With the utmost respect, he called them a "bunch of misfits".
